The Manufacturing Master Data Administrator (MDA) will support and govern SAP master data across a complex manufacturing environment. This role is critical to ensuring the accuracy, integrity, and control of data supporting production planning, inventory, and costing.
The Manufacturing Master Data Administrator (MDA) will work closely with manufacturing, finance, and SAP advisors during post go-live and BAU stabilisation, acting as a central point of control for manufacturing-related master data.
Key Responsibilities
Create, maintain, and govern manufacturing master data in SAP, including:
Material master (manufacturing and planning views)
Bills of Materials (BOMs)
Routings and work centres
Production versions and planning parameters
Ensure master data changes follow agreed governance and approval processes
Assess and manage the operational and financial impact of data changes
Support manufacturing users and resolve master data issues
Work alongside SAP advisors during hypercare and transition to BAU
Participate in data quality reviews, audits, and continuous improvement initiatives
